Krill
By Sheri Skelton |
|
1 Krill are little animals that look like tiny shrimp. They live in every ocean in the world. Krill are sometimes referred to as a keystone species. They have a very important role in the ocean's ecosystem. Krill provide food for many animals, including fish, birds, seals, penguins, and even whales. Krill are especially important in the Antarctic. Scientists believe that if krill were to disappear, then most other animals in the Antarctic would also disappear.![]() |
